Floyd County, TX Census Records
What Floyd County, TX census records are available?
There are many types of census records for Floyd County guide you in researching your family tree. Federal Population Schedules are available for 1880 (free index), 1890 (fragment), 1900, 1910, 1920, 1930, 1940.
Floyd Co. Mortality Schedules can be found for 1880. Floyd Co. Industry and Agriculture can be obtained for 1880. Floyd Co. Union Veterans Schedules is available for 1890.
Another census resource is the Texas, Compiled Census and Census Substitutes Index from 1820-1890. One can find free online and printable census forms to help you with your research. See Also Texas Census Records Research Guide.
Floyd County, TX Courthouse and Government Records
What genealogical records can I find in the Floyd County Courthouse?
The below facts shows exactly what death, marriage, birth, property, wills, and court records are typically in Floyd County. The years listed below are the first noted records with this county. See Also Texas Courthouse Records Research Guide.
- Floyd County Courthouse (all departments listed below are located here, unless otherwise noted)
- Address: 105 Main, Room 101, Floydada 79235
- Floyd County Clerk
- Phone: (806) 983-4900
- Birth & Death Records: 1903
- Marriage Records: 1890
- Land Records: 1890
- Probate Records: 1890
- Court Records: 1890
